“Ocean’s Fourteen” Green Lit By Studios; What We Know About The New “Ocean’s” Instalment

When it comes to Hollywood heist movies, a few come to mind, but the “Ocean’s” franchise may be at the top of everybody’s list. The franchise is an icon in the genre and has spawned many instalments, including a spin-off.

After years of waiting, Danny Ocean himself, George Clooney, confirmed that “Ocean’s Fourteen” is in the works. While not much is known about the storyline, there are some confirmed details about the movie. Here’s what we know about “Ocean’s 14” so far:

Filming Will Start In 2026

In a recent interview, George Clooney confirmed that Warner Bros have approved the budget for the new instalment, so filming would start once the cast and crew could work out the scheduling. According to the actor, filming will begin in nine or ten months, or in 2026. This means the movie is looking at a 2028-2029 release date at the earliest.

Many Of The Cast Expected To Return

George also confirmed that many of the original cast members would return for the new film, including himself, Brad Pitt, Matt Damon, Don Cheadle and Julia Roberts. Unfortunately, “Ocean’s 14” won’t see the return of two beloved characters, Frank Catton and Saul Bloom, as their actors, Bernie Mac and Carl Reiner, passed away in 2008 and 2020, respectively.

“The Fall Guy” Filmmaker To Helm Director’s Chair

No blockbuster heist movie is complete without a dynamic director. According to reports, David Leitch is set to direct the new “Ocean’s” film, taking over for Steven Soderbergh, who directed the original trilogy. David is the director behind action-packed works like “Deadpool 2” and “The Fall Guy”. He’s also working on another heist movie, “How To Rob A Bank”.

Besides “Ocean’s Fourteen”, another prequel is in the works, which follows Danny and Debbie’s parents, played by Margot Robbie and Ryan Gosling. Are you excited for the new “Ocean’s” sequel and prequel?
